Abstract

Calcium isotope determination in urine samples by HR CS GFMAS via CaF molecules. pH is a factor to consider guaranteeing the efficacy of CaF formation. Due to Cl interference, Ca should be separated from solutions by precipitation with (NH4)2C2O4.
